Actions
Bug #19397
closedRework the style tests
Pull Request:
Severity:
UX impact:
User visibility:
Effort required:
Priority:
0
Name check:
To do
Fix check:
To do
Regression:
Description
The style tests are currently way too complicated for what they do.
We should clean up the tests, a first step is to pass all the tests in the same formats. We have our own 'testall' that runs bash and python tests
that do not requires any test framework overlay.
I will translate all the tests located in the 30_generic_methods in python using unittest since some tests already use it.
This way, it should be easier to understand what each test does since they will follow a documented and standard format, callable in a single line.
Updated by Félix DALLIDET over 3 years ago
- Status changed from New to In progress
- Assignee set to Félix DALLIDET
Updated by Félix DALLIDET over 3 years ago
- Status changed from In progress to Pending technical review
- Assignee changed from Félix DALLIDET to Alexis Mousset
- Pull Request set to https://github.com/Normation/ncf/pull/1297
Updated by Félix DALLIDET over 3 years ago
- Status changed from Pending technical review to In progress
- Assignee changed from Alexis Mousset to Félix DALLIDET
I'm taking over this issue!
Updated by Vincent MEMBRÉ over 3 years ago
- Target version changed from 6.1.14 to 6.1.15
Updated by Vincent MEMBRÉ over 3 years ago
- Target version changed from 6.1.15 to 6.1.16
Updated by Vincent MEMBRÉ over 3 years ago
- Target version changed from 6.1.16 to 6.1.17
Updated by Benoît PECCATTE about 3 years ago
- Project changed from 41 to Rudder
- Category changed from CI to CI
Updated by Vincent MEMBRÉ about 3 years ago
- Target version changed from 6.1.17 to 6.1.18
Updated by Vincent MEMBRÉ almost 3 years ago
- Target version changed from 6.1.18 to 6.1.19
Updated by Alexis Mousset almost 3 years ago
- Status changed from In progress to New
Updated by Alexis Mousset almost 3 years ago
- Status changed from New to Rejected
Actions